LONDON: Liquefied natural gas (LNG) spot prices fell to $15.30 per million British thermal units (mmBtu) this week as African suppliers pumped out more cargoes in a spree of tenders aimed at Asian and Latin American buyers.
Asian LNG prices were pegged in the mid-$15/mmBtu level last week.
